"Elric la fin des temps" by Michael Moorcock is an enthralling and captivating fantasy novel that serves as the culmination of the renowned Elric of Melniboné series. With its dark and intricate world, the story revolves around the tormented protagonist Elric, an albino emperor burdened with a soul-devouring sword, as he confronts the forces of chaos that threaten to annihilate his realm.

Moorcock's writing style is impeccably descriptive, painting a richly imaginative and immersive setting. The author effortlessly transports readers into a decadent and somber world brimming with complex political schemes, epic battles, and profound philosophical reflections. The depth of the world-building is truly impressive, woven with intricately developed characters and layered mythologies that bring a wealth of complexity to the narrative.

Elric himself is a mesmerizing and deeply flawed hero. Moorcock skillfully delves into the internal struggle of Elric's dual nature, torn between his thirst for power and his reluctance to succumb to the destructive forces of his sword. As the series reaches its climax in "Elric la fin des temps," Elric undergoes profound character growth, rendering him an even more intriguing and dynamic figure.
